Still white wine made from Vermentino di Gallura DOCG, 13.5% ABV, produced by Masone Mannu. 100% Vermentino, 0.75L bottle, 2023 vintage. A wine born in the heart of Gallura, Sardinia, where Vermentino expresses its characteristics best thanks to the climate and soil. Fine and elegant, with floral notes, ripe fruit, and a hint of lemongrass. Fresh and fruity on the palate, this wine captivates with its freshness and minerality.

The ancient name "Masone Mannu" means "great property", which extends for almost 100 hectares, of which about 40 are planted with specialized vineyard.
Since 2018 the Estate is the subject of a big development project led by Giordano Emendatori, owner of the Tenuta Mara Biodynamic Estate in Romagna. In our vineyards we mainly grow the most important grape in Gallura: Vermentino. Cannonau, Carignano vines, together with Bovale Sardo, Merlot and Cabernet Sauvignon enrich the cultivated varieties.
The sea wind, the exposure of the vineyards and the rich nature surrounding the estate help us to grow healthy grapes without the use of pesticides, herbicides and chemical fertilizers. Read more
